iOS签名全面解析,解决苹果重签等问题

在iOS开发中,签名是一个不可或缺的环节,它可以确保应用程序的完整性和可信度,并保护用户隐私。iOS签名主要分为苹果签名和企业签名两种方式,下面就为大家详细介绍。

苹果签名

苹果签名是iOS开发中的标准签名,通过Apple Developer中心的证书和配置文件,应用程序可以被苹果服务器认可并安装到用户的设备中。苹果签名包括开发者证书、移动设备管理证书、用于代码签名的证书、描述文件等。

在使用苹果签名时,要注意以下问题:

苹果签名的证书和描述文件有有效期限制,需要定期更新。

苹果针对重签等行为进行了限制,对于未经苹果认证或复写的应用程序,用户将无法安装或运行。

针对苹果重签问题,苹果可以选择撤销开发者账号或关闭对应的证书,导致应用程序无法通过苹果服务器认证。

企业签名

企业签名是一种针对企业内部使用的签名方式,需要企业开发者账号进行签名并发布到设备中。企业签名可以避免苹果签名的诸多限制,并提供企业定制化的应用程序。

在使用企业签名时,需要注意以下问题:

iOS签名全面解析,解决苹果重签等问题

企业签名只能用于企业内部使用,禁止通过App Store等途径发布或商业化。

苹果有权随时撤销企业签名,对于滥用企业签名的情况,苹果有权采取禁用账号等行动。

企业签名需要保证应用程序的完整性和安全性,防止代码被恶意篡改或攻击。

苹果重签问题解决

针对苹果重签等问题,我们可以采取以下解决方案:

使用苹果签名,遵守苹果的开发规范和限制,保证应用程序的完整性和信任度。

采取应用程序加固措施,加密代码、混淆算法等,提高代码的安全性,降低被篡改的风险。

使用第三方代码审核工具,加强对应用程序的审查和监测,及时发现漏洞和风险,并做出相应的处理。

总之,在使用iOS签名时,我们需要合理而谨慎地进行操作,遵守苹果开发规范,保证应用程序的安全和信任度。

相关新闻

联系我们

联系我们

QQ:2869296718

在线咨询:点击这里给我发消息

联系微信
联系微信
分享本页
返回顶部